CJCH Solicitors is a thriving, award-winning legal practice with offices in Cardiff, Barry, Bridgend and Blackwood. The firm’s Court of Protection department is seeking an experienced paralegal to join its thriving team. This is a rare opportunity to join the leading Court of Protection team in Wales. The role is permanent, to commence as soon as possible.
Role requirements
- Previous Court of Protection experience is desirable but not essential.
- The candidate should have a strong interest in human rights law, mental capacity law, medical based law, welfare law, or a passion for helping people who are unable to advocate for themselves.
- Have excellent interpersonal skills and an ability to be empathetic when working with vulnerable adults.
- Be organised and proactive to thrive in a busy department that works to tight court deadlines.
- Have excellent IT literacy and experience of legal case management systems.
- Experience in legal aid is desirable.
Full training will be provided. The role offers the opportunity for development to qualification for the right candidate.
